diff --git a/misc/metrics/Cargo.toml b/misc/metrics/Cargo.toml index 7ffd5d5d8be..7bf3e0abda8 100644 --- a/misc/metrics/Cargo.toml +++ b/misc/metrics/Cargo.toml @@ -22,7 +22,7 @@ libp2p-identify = { version = "0.33.0", path = "../../protocols/identify", optio libp2p-kad = { version = "0.34.0", path = "../../protocols/kad", optional = true } libp2p-ping = { version = "0.33.0", path = "../../protocols/ping", optional = true } libp2p-swarm = { version = "0.33.0", path = "../../swarm" } -open-metrics-client = "0.12.0" +open-metrics-client = "0.13.0" [dev-dependencies] env_logger = "0.8.1" diff --git a/misc/metrics/src/kad.rs b/misc/metrics/src/kad.rs index 61056f3698e..05a9e8454c1 100644 --- a/misc/metrics/src/kad.rs +++ b/misc/metrics/src/kad.rs @@ -90,7 +90,7 @@ impl Metrics { Box::new(query_result_get_providers_error.clone()), ); - let query_result_num_requests = + let query_result_num_requests: Family<_, _> = Family::new_with_constructor(|| Histogram::new(exponential_buckets(1.0, 2.0, 10))); sub_registry.register( "query_result_num_requests", @@ -98,7 +98,7 @@ impl Metrics { Box::new(query_result_num_requests.clone()), ); - let query_result_num_success = + let query_result_num_success: Family<_, _> = Family::new_with_constructor(|| Histogram::new(exponential_buckets(1.0, 2.0, 10))); sub_registry.register( "query_result_num_success", @@ -106,7 +106,7 @@ impl Metrics { Box::new(query_result_num_success.clone()), ); - let query_result_num_failure = + let query_result_num_failure: Family<_, _> = Family::new_with_constructor(|| Histogram::new(exponential_buckets(1.0, 2.0, 10))); sub_registry.register( "query_result_num_failure", @@ -114,7 +114,7 @@ impl Metrics { Box::new(query_result_num_failure.clone()), ); - let query_result_duration = + let query_result_duration: Family<_, _> = Family::new_with_constructor(|| Histogram::new(exponential_buckets(0.1, 2.0, 10))); sub_registry.register_with_unit( "query_result_duration", diff --git a/protocols/gossipsub/Cargo.toml b/protocols/gossipsub/Cargo.toml index bfb1d3a4cd8..f4e17ab9d08 100644 --- a/protocols/gossipsub/Cargo.toml +++ b/protocols/gossipsub/Cargo.toml @@ -30,7 +30,7 @@ futures-timer = "3.0.2" pin-project = "1.0.8" instant = "0.1.11" # Metrics dependencies -open-metrics-client = "0.12" +open-metrics-client = "0.13" [dev-dependencies] async-std = "1.6.3"